My kick start into music was when I was in high school at the age of 15. I had the burning desire to be in a band even though I couldn’t play at all.
So I picked up the guitar and started playing. I went to some guitar lessons in the beginning and I improved quickly so it didn´t take long before I was practicing Paul Gilbert style picking and Yngwie Malmsteens sweep patterns.
For me it was all about speed. How to play heavier, harder and faster all the time.
After a while of being in bands and basically just repeating Marty Friedman and Yngwie style playing I got bored and I had to explore more guitar techniques and playing styles to make myself a more versatile player.
There is a strange thing with us Asian born guitar players. We are all trying to play faster and come up with more insane tricks than the other guy. There is a lot of technical skill in that part of the world but when it comes to actually composing the players in my country are still today mostly just repeating stuff that the western society has produced guitar wise.
The reason for me to play music is to show the people my emotions and to open up my heart and soul every time I get on a stage. Music is my freedom until I die…
